The global wireless fetal monitoring system market size is estimated to be valued at US$ 1,852.6 million in 2024. A CAGR of 6.9% is anticipated through 2034. The market is projected to account for a valuation of US$ 3,593.7 million by 2034.

Technological Advancements:

Technological innovations have been a key driver in shaping the Wireless Fetal Monitoring System Market. Integration of wireless communication technologies such as Bluetooth and Wi-Fi has enabled seamless data transmission, providing real-time monitoring capabilities. Smart wearable devices equipped with fetal monitoring sensors allow expectant mothers to participate actively in their prenatal care, fostering a sense of empowerment and engagement.

The use of art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ning algorithms in these systems has further enhanced their diagnostic capabilities. These advanced algorithms can analyze complex patterns in fetal heart rate and uterine contractions, providing more accurate and timely insights into fetal well-being. This trend towards digitalization and data-driven decision-making is propelling the market forward.

Market Challenges:

Despite the promising growth, the Wireless Fetal Monitoring System Market faces certain challenges. Concerns related to data security and privacy, interoperability issues with existing healthcare systems, and the high initial cost of implementation pose hurdles to widespread adoption. Addressing these challenges is crucial to ensuring the sustained growth and acceptance of wireless fetal monitoring technologies.

Global Market Outlook:

The Wireless Fetal Monitoring System Market is witnessing substantial growth across various regions. North America and Europe lead the market, driven by well-established healthcare infrastructures, high awareness levels, and favorable reimbursement policies. Meanwhile, emerging economies in Asia-Pacific and Latin America are experiencing rapid market growth, fueled by increasing healthcare investments, rising disposable incomes, and a growing emphasis on maternal and infant healthcare.
